Subject: [PATCH] Remove machine_is(chrp) from 64-bit kernel
Date: Sat, 06 Jun 2009 17:38:10 +0100	[thread overview]
Message-ID: <1244306290.3751.2032.camel@macbook.infradead.org> (raw)

The CHRP platform type only exists in a 32-bit build. Don't bother
checking machine_is(chrp) if we're in 64-bit mode.

Signed-off-by: David Woodhouse <David.Woodhouse@intel.com>

diff --git a/arch/powerpc/platforms/powermac/setup.c b/arch/powerpc/platforms/powermac/setup.c
index 45936c9..c22f7e8 100644
--- a/arch/powerpc/platforms/powermac/setup.c
+++ b/arch/powerpc/platforms/powermac/setup.c
@@ -518,9 +518,10 @@ static int __init pmac_declare_of_platform_devices(void)
 {
 	struct device_node *np;
 
+#ifdef CONFIG_PPC32
 	if (machine_is(chrp))
 		return -1;
-
+#endif
 	np = of_find_node_by_name(NULL, "valkyrie");
 	if (np)
 		of_platform_device_create(np, "valkyrie", NULL);
